At its core, the distinction lies in the creation versus the access of an account. When you sign up, you are essentially initiating the process of registering to create a new user profile or account. This action signifies your intent to become a recognized user within a system, service, or applicationQuestion 1: Difference between Sign-in and Sign-up. Think of it as the first step, where you provide the necessary information—often including an email address, username, and a secure password—to establish your digital identity. For example, when you join a new social media platform or subscribe to a new online service, you will typically be prompted to sign up. This process is akin to filling out an application to become a member.

Conversely, sign in refers to the act of accessing an account that already exists.Difference between sign up and sign in Once you have successfully completed the sign up process, you will then use your credentials to sign in each time you wish to access your personalized space. This is essentially authenticating your identity to gain entry. As stated in many contexts, "Sign-in is when you access an existing account."
